Five-Spice Chicken Wings

Five-spice powder is often used in Chinese-inspired dishes such as these tantalizing appetizer wings.

Servings: about 32 pieces

Ingredients

  • 3  pounds  chicken wings (about 16)On Sale
  • 1  cup  bottled plum sauceOn Sale
  • 2  tablespoons  butter, meltedOn Sale
  • 1  teaspoon  five-spice powderOn Sale
  •     Thin orange wedges and pineapple slices (optional)On Sale

Directions
1.
If desired, use a sharp knife to carefully cut off tips of the wings; discard wing tips. In a foil-lined 15x10x1-inch shallow baking pan arrange wing pieces in a single layer. Bake in a 375 degree F oven for 20 minutes. Drain well.
2.
For sauce, in a 3-1/2- or 4-quart slow cooker combine plum sauce, melted butter, and five-spice powder. Add wing pieces, stirring to coat with sauce.
3.
Cover; cook on low-heat setting for 4 to 5 hours or on high-heat setting for 2 to 2-1/2 hours.
4.
Serve immediately or keep covered on low-heat setting for up to 2 hours. If desired, garnish with orange wedges and pineapple slices. Makes about 32 pieces.

Kentucky Chicken Wings
Prepare chicken as in Step 1. For sauce, in slow cooker combine 1/2 cup maple syrup, 1/2 cup whiskey, and 2 tablespoons melted butter. Add wing pieces, stirring to coat with sauce. Continue as in Step 3.

Buffalo-Style Chicken Wings
Prepare chicken as in Step 1. For sauce, in slow cooker combine 1-1/2 cups hot-style barbecue sauce, 2 tablespoons melted butter, and 1 to 2 teaspoons bottled hot pepper sauce. Add wing pieces, stirring to coat with sauce. Continue as in Step 3. Serve with bottled blue cheese or ranch salad dressing. Omit the fruit garnish.

Nutrition information
Calories 88, Total Fat 6 g, Saturated Fat 2 g, Monounsaturated Fat 0 g, Polyunsaturated Fat 0 g, Cholesterol 35 mg, Sodium 41 mg, Carbohydrate 3 g, Total Sugar 0 g, Fiber 0 g, Protein 6 g. Daily Values: Vitamin C 0%, Calcium 1%, Iron 0%. Percent Daily Values are based on a 2,000 calorie diet
